Product details

Overview

A6277EA-T from Allegro MicroSystems is an 8-bit serial-input constant-current latched LED driver with NPN sink outputs, designed for multiplexed LED display systems. It integrates a CMOS shift register, data latches, and eight 150 mA-rated constant-current drivers, supporting up to 20 MHz serial data input at 5 V logic supply and enabling inter-digit blanking via ENABLE control.

For engineers reviewing the A6277EA-T datasheet, A6277EA-T pinout, A6277EA-T application, or A6277EA-T equivalent, key selection considerations include its 20-pin DIP package, user-programmable output current via REXT, HIGH/LOW current scaling (100% or 50%), undervoltage lockout, and cascade-capable dual serial data outputs (SDO1/SDO2).

Technical Context

The A6277EA-T implements a serial-to-parallel architecture where rising-edge clock shifts data into an 8-bit shift register, and a high-level LATCH ENABLE transfers contents to independent output latches-enabling continuous data loading while holding stable outputs. Its dual serial outputs (SDO1 on rising edge, SDO2 on falling edge) support daisy-chained configurations without external logic.

Output current is set by a single external resistor (REXT) connected to pin 19, establishing identical sink current across all eight outputs; the HIGH/LOW input (pin 5) provides hardware-selectable 100% or 50% current scaling per bit, while OUTPUT ENABLE (pin 16, active-low) globally blanks all outputs with no effect on latch state.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Output Type NPN constant-current sink drivers (8-channel)
Max Output Current 150 mA per channel at VCE = 1.0 V, TA = 85°C (DIP package)
Serial Data Rate Up to 20 MHz at VDD = 5 V - enables fast refresh in high-resolution LED matrices
Logic Supply Voltage 4.5–5.5 V - compatible with standard 5 V microcontroller I/O
Undervoltage Lockout Triggers below VDD(UV) = 4.3 V - prevents erratic operation during power ramp-up
Current Scaling Hardware-selectable 100% or 50% via HIGH/LOW pin - supports dynamic brightness control without PWM
Package Thermal Resistance RθJA = 60°C/W (DIP, 1-layer PCB) - enables sustained 122 mA total sink current at 85°C ambient

Pinout & Package

20-pin through-hole DIP (suffix A), Pb-free with 100% matte-tin leadframe plating. Copper leadframe enables high thermal performance and continuous 122 mA total sink current over –40°C to +85°C.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
1 LOGIC GROUND Reference for all digital inputs and internal logic - must be isolated from power ground to avoid noise coupling
2 SERIAL DATA IN CMOS-compatible serial data input to shift register - accepts 20 MHz rates at 5 V logic
3 CLOCK Rising-edge-triggered shift clock - initiates data load into shift register
4 LATCH ENABLE High-level strobe transfers shift register contents to output latches - allows asynchronous parallel update
5 HIGH/LOW (CURRENT) Selects full (100%) or half (50%) programmed current per output - enables coarse dimming without software overhead
6, 15 POWER GROUND Return path for all eight sink outputs - separate from logic ground to minimize switching noise interference
7–14 OUT0–OUT7 Constant-current NPN sink terminals - each delivers user-set current (via REXT) to LED cathodes
16 OUTPUT ENABLE Active-low global blanking - disables all outputs while preserving latch state for instant re-enable
17 SERIAL OUT2 CMOS serial output triggered on clock falling edge - supports cascading to next device in chain
18 SERIAL OUT1 CMOS serial output triggered on clock rising edge - enables synchronous daisy-chain timing
19 REXT Connection point for external current-setting resistor - sets identical sink current for all eight outputs
20 LOGIC SUPPLY (VDD) 5 V ±0.5 V CMOS logic supply - powers shift register, latches, and interface circuitry

Key Features

Feature Design Value
8-bit serial-to-parallel conversion Enables microcontroller GPIO reduction - only 3 pins (DATA, CLOCK, LATCH) needed to drive 8 LEDs
User-programmable constant current Single REXT resistor sets precise, matched output current across all channels - eliminates per-LED resistors
Dual-edge serial output SDO1 (rising edge) and SDO2 (falling edge) allow seamless daisy-chaining without added delay or skew
Inter-digit blanking Active-high ENABLE input disables all outputs simultaneously - essential for time-multiplexed LED displays
Digital current scaling HIGH/LOW pin provides hardware-based 2× brightness step - reduces firmware complexity vs. PWM dimming

Applications

LED Segment Displays Dot-Matrix LED Panels

Use Scenario: Driving 7-segment or 14-segment alphanumeric displays in industrial HMIs, instrumentation panels, and point-of-sale terminals.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Constant-current sink driver providing stable segment current during multiplexed scanning cycles.

Use Value: Eliminates segment brightness variation across digits using matched current sources and inter-digit blanking synchronization.

Use Scenario: Controlling rows/columns in monochrome or tri-color LED matrix displays used in signage, scoreboards, and status indicators.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Row driver with daisy-chain capability enabling scalable column addressing across large arrays.

Use Value: Dual serial outputs (SDO1/SDO2) maintain precise timing alignment across cascaded devices - critical for flicker-free scanning.

LED Bar Graphs Industrial Annunciator Panels

Use Scenario: Driving linear LED bar graphs in analog meter replacements, audio level indicators, and process monitoring dashboards.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Serially updated current sink array delivering uniform brightness across all segments under varying ambient temperature.

Use Value: Undervoltage lockout and thermal derating curves ensure consistent LED intensity even during brownout or high-temperature operation.

Use Scenario: Providing fault-indicating LED illumination in safety-critical industrial control cabinets and PLC I/O modules.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Latched driver maintaining LED state independently of serial bus activity - ensures fail-safe visual indication.

Use Value: Output latches retain state during microcontroller reset or communication interruption - guarantees persistent alarm visibility.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ar constant-current LED driver appl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
Toshiba TD62715FN Pin-compatible 20-pin DIP; identical functional block diagram and REXT-based current setting; lacks undervoltage lockout No UVLO protection - requires external supervision in unstable power environments Valid drop-in replacement where UVLO is not required and legacy Toshiba sourcing is preferred
ON Semiconductor CAT4016 16-pin SOIC; 16-channel vs. 8-channel; uses internal current reference (no REXT); max 100 mA/channel Higher channel count but lower per-channel current and no HIGH/LOW scaling function Preferred for space-constrained designs needing more outputs, but not suitable for 150 mA or hardware dimming needs

Compared with A6277EA-T, TD62715FN offers identical pinout and current programming but omits undervoltage lockout, while CAT4016 trades channel count and package size for reduced current capability and loss of hardware current scaling - making A6277EA-T optimal for robust, high-current, multiplexed LED displays requiring thermal stability and simple brightness control.

FAQ

What is the maximum continuous output current per channel for A6277EA-T at 85°C ambient?

The A6277EA-T delivers up to 122 mA total sink current across all eight outputs continuously at 85°C ambient when mounted on a 1-layer PCB (RθJA = 60°C/W). Per-channel current depends on duty cycle and VCE; at 100% duty and VCE = 1.0 V, individual outputs sustain 150 mA - verified in Allegro's thermal characterization data for the DIP package.

How does the HIGH/LOW pin on A6277EA-T affect LED brightness control?

The HIGH/LOW pin (pin 5) on A6277EA-T provides hardware-selectable current scaling: a logic low enables 100% of the REXT-programmed current per output, while a logic high reduces it to 50%. This enables coarse brightness adjustment without PWM timing overhead or firmware intervention - ideal for static display intensity tuning in industrial HMIs.

Can A6277EA-T be cascaded with other A6277EA-T devices, and how is data synchronized?

Yes, A6277EA-T supports daisy-chaining via two dedicated serial outputs: SDO1 (pin 18, triggered on clock rising edge) and SDO2 (pin 17, triggered on clock falling edge). This dual-edge architecture ensures deterministic, skew-free data propagation across multiple A6277EA-T devices - eliminating timing jitter in large LED arrays requiring synchronized column updates.

What is the role of separate LOGIC GROUND and POWER GROUND pins on A6277EA-T?

A6277EA-T uses isolated LOGIC GROUND (pin 1) and POWER GROUND (pins 6 and 15) to prevent switching noise from high-current LED sinks from corrupting digital inputs (CLOCK, LATCH ENABLE, etc.). If shared, voltage spikes exceeding 2.5 V between system ground and control pins may cause mislatching - proper PCB layout with separate ground planes is mandatory for reliable A6277EA-T operation.

Does A6277EA-T include built-in protection features beyond undervoltage lockout?

Yes, A6277EA-T incorporates Class 2 input static protection on all logic pins, safeguarding against ESD events up to ±2 kV (HBM). While not featuring overtemperature shutdown, its thermal derating curves (provided in Allegro's datasheet Figure GP-062) define safe operating current limits across ambient temperature and duty cycle - enabling robust design without external thermal monitoring.
